Certificate rejected by mobile browsers

I configure Google App Engine to work with Letsencrypt. It works properly when accessed via Desktop. But it throws “untrusted site” warning on mobile browser.

Sounds like your not sending the correct intermediate cert, check it with this or a similar service. The only reason for your desktop browser accepting it is that it cached the intermediate from a previously visited site that was correctly configured.

